Welcome to the Stormline fan-out team. The alert router at Pellcrest shards by region and retries failed pushes twice before parking them in the dead-letter topic. Dashboards live under the Fanout folder. If the signing vault is sealed when you rotate credentials during an incident, unseal it with the recovery passphrase, which is kept directly below this paragraph for on-call use.

recovery phrase for kahof-hawif: holok-julvan-eliax-ulaath-briath

Handover Note — From Director M. Trevane to Director S. Olbeck

Pricing on the Corrivane line remains tiered: standard, plus, and enterprise. Margins are thinnest on plus; hold list prices through the review. Regional adjustments for the Dalwich territory are pending finance approval. Heads of department should not quote revised rates yet. The underlying rationale is set out below.

confidential, yagep-kagef: Rusvanox Holdings is in early talks to buy Julwynix Systems for about $454.5 million. The Fenael launch date is April 23, and nothing goes to the press before then. Legal wants the Druwynix Works term sheet redrafted before January 8.

FAQ: Why does the Quillbatch CSV import wizard reject files over 50 MB?

The wizard streams rows through the Fennmore validation layer, which buffers an entire chunk before committing. Larger files exceed the sandbox memory cap, so we hard-fail early rather than risk partial imports. Reviewers checking the chunking branch should verify the cap constant matches the deploy config, not the test fixture. If you need to run the oversized-file regression suite locally, unlock the fixture vault with the passphrase below.

strongbox words: gilok-druion-briath-wendor-briion-prawyn-fenion-oliir-casdor-holius-briius-gilath-gilael-pelys

Ticket: Staging env misconfigured for Siftgate bloom filter

The bloom layer in front of the Pellet KV store is rejecting all lookups in staging because the env file was copied from the dev template without credentials. False-positive tuning values are fine; only the auth line is missing. To unblock the weekly demo, the Pellet admission secret must be set on the following line.

env line for yaguf-fajop: LEDGER_TOKEN13=fb08984397349